Singapore Day 3: A Universal Christmas at Universal Studios

On December 30, 2024 , we visited Universal Studios Singapore as part of our third of five days in Singapore. The theme park is the first and only Universal-themed Park in Southeast Asia, having opened in 2011. This is actually my fourth time visiting this park following our first three visits in 2013, 2015, and 2019. Singapore Day 2: Gardens by the Bay, Little India, and more!

Continuing our year-end "escapade" in Singapore was a visit to Bras Basah, followed by Little India, before being trapped at Singapore Botanic Gardens for three hours due to a heavy rainfall. We then ended the day with a Christmas Wonderland visit at Gardens by the Bay. Despite the rainfall, we successfully concluded the day with more attractions and new treats. Singapore Day 1: Changi Airport and Sentosa's Wings of Time

It started as a sunny late morning from our Cebu Pacific flight on December 28, 2024 . As my mother and I walked down the elegant corridor of Changi Airport's Terminal 4, we were preparing for something extraordinary: an overseas Christmas vacation, which I embarked for the very first time after spending the yuletide holidays every year in my home country, the Philippines. This is actually my sixth time  visiting Singapore, having been visited there for the past five times every two years from 2013 to 2019, and in 2022. New Year's trip on Cebu Pacific to Singapore (flight review)

The five days from December 28, 2024, to January 1, 2025, constitutes the longest possible "weekend" in a calendar year. Since my favorite season to travel is Christmas (and by extension, New Year), we took this opportunity to book a round-trip ticket via Cebu Pacific for my first year-end vacation outside the Philippines.
